How 71933 compares in the Hot Springs, AR area

ZIP code 71933 (Bonnerdale, AR) has a typical home value of $256,687 as of June 2026, ranking 5th of 8 ZIP codes tracked in the Hot Springs, AR area, more expensive than about 50% of ZIP codes in the metro. Prices here have moved +0.2% over the trailing 12 months. Over the past five years, the typical value in this ZIP code has changed +27.5%, from $201,249 in June 2021 to $256,687 in June 2026.

Population and demographics

ZIP code 71933 has a population of 1,162, per the Census Bureau's American Community Survey 5-year estimate. By race and ethnicity: 98.9% White, 0.7% two or more races, and 0.5% another race.
